  7. CanvasModulate
  8. ==============
  9. **Inherits:** :ref:`Node2D<class_Node2D>` **<** :ref:`CanvasItem<class_CanvasItem>` **<** :ref:`Node<class_Node>` **<** :ref:`Object<class_Object>`
  10. A node that applies a color tint to a canvas.
  11. .. rst-class:: classref-introduction-group
  12. Description
  13. -----------
  14. **CanvasModulate** applies a color tint to all nodes on a canvas. Only one can be used to tint a canvas, but :ref:`CanvasLayer<class_CanvasLayer>`\ s can be used to render things independently.
